[1/4] media: uvcvideo: Refactor uvc_ctrl_set_handle()

Message ID 20250509-uvc-followup-v1-1-73bcde30d2b5@chromium.org
State New
Headers show
Series media: uvcvideo: Follow-up patches for next-media-uvc-20250509 | expand

Commit Message

Ricardo Ribalda May 9, 2025, 6:24 p.m. UTC
Today uvc_ctrl_set_handle() covers two use-uses: setting the handle and
clearing the handle. The only common code between the two cases is the
lockdep_assert_held.

The code looks cleaner if we split these two usecases in two functions.

We also take this opportunity to use pending_async_ctrls from ctrl where
possible.

Signed-off-by: Ricardo Ribalda <ribalda@chromium.org>
---
 drivers/media/usb/uvc/uvc_ctrl.c | 65 +++++++++++++++++++++-------------------
 1 file changed, 35 insertions(+), 30 deletions(-)

Patch

diff --git a/drivers/media/usb/uvc/uvc_ctrl.c b/drivers/media/usb/uvc/uvc_ctrl.c
index 44b6513c526421943bb9841fb53dc5f8e9f93f02..26be1d0a1891cf3a9a7489f60f9a2931c78d3239 100644
--- a/drivers/media/usb/uvc/uvc_ctrl.c
+++ b/drivers/media/usb/uvc/uvc_ctrl.c
@@ -1812,48 +1812,53 @@  static void uvc_ctrl_send_slave_event(struct uvc_video_chain *chain,
 	uvc_ctrl_send_event(chain, handle, ctrl, mapping, val, changes);
 }
 
-static int uvc_ctrl_set_handle(struct uvc_fh *handle, struct uvc_control *ctrl,
-			       struct uvc_fh *new_handle)
+static int uvc_ctrl_set_handle(struct uvc_fh *handle, struct uvc_control *ctrl)
 {
-	lockdep_assert_held(&handle->chain->ctrl_mutex);
-
-	if (new_handle) {
-		int ret;
+	int ret;
 
-		if (ctrl->handle)
-			dev_warn_ratelimited(&handle->stream->dev->udev->dev,
-					     "UVC non compliance: Setting an async control with a pending operation.");
+	lockdep_assert_held(&handle->chain->ctrl_mutex);
 
-		if (new_handle == ctrl->handle)
-			return 0;
+	if (ctrl->handle) {
+		dev_warn_ratelimited(&handle->stream->dev->udev->dev,
+				     "UVC non compliance: Setting an async control with a pending operation.");
 
-		if (ctrl->handle) {
-			WARN_ON(!ctrl->handle->pending_async_ctrls);
-			if (ctrl->handle->pending_async_ctrls)
-				ctrl->handle->pending_async_ctrls--;
-			ctrl->handle = new_handle;
-			handle->pending_async_ctrls++;
+		if (ctrl->handle == handle)
 			return 0;
-		}
-
-		ret = uvc_pm_get(handle->chain->dev);
-		if (ret)
-			return ret;
 
-		ctrl->handle = new_handle;
-		handle->pending_async_ctrls++;
+		WARN_ON(!ctrl->handle->pending_async_ctrls);
+		if (ctrl->handle->pending_async_ctrls)
+			ctrl->handle->pending_async_ctrls--;
+		ctrl->handle = handle;
+		ctrl->handle->pending_async_ctrls++;
 		return 0;
 	}
 
+	ret = uvc_pm_get(handle->chain->dev);
+	if (ret)
+		return ret;
+
+	ctrl->handle = handle;
+	ctrl->handle->pending_async_ctrls++;
+	return 0;
+}
+
+static int uvc_ctrl_clear_handle(struct uvc_fh *handle,
+				 struct uvc_control *ctrl)
+{
+	lockdep_assert_held(&handle->chain->ctrl_mutex);
+
 	/* Cannot clear the handle for a control not owned by us.*/
 	if (WARN_ON(ctrl->handle != handle))
 		return -EINVAL;
 
-	ctrl->handle = NULL;
-	if (WARN_ON(!handle->pending_async_ctrls))
+	if (WARN_ON(!ctrl->handle->pending_async_ctrls)) {
+		ctrl->handle = NULL;
 		return -EINVAL;
-	handle->pending_async_ctrls--;
+	}
+
+	ctrl->handle->pending_async_ctrls--;
 	uvc_pm_put(handle->chain->dev);
+	ctrl->handle = NULL;
 	return 0;
 }
 
@@ -1871,7 +1876,7 @@  void uvc_ctrl_status_event(struct uvc_video_chain *chain,
 
 	handle = ctrl->handle;
 	if (handle)
-		uvc_ctrl_set_handle(handle, ctrl, NULL);
+		uvc_ctrl_clear_handle(handle, ctrl);
 
 	list_for_each_entry(mapping, &ctrl->info.mappings, list) {
 		s32 value;
@@ -2161,7 +2166,7 @@  static int uvc_ctrl_commit_entity(struct uvc_device *dev,
 
 		if (!rollback && handle && !ret &&
 		    ctrl->info.flags & UVC_CTRL_FLAG_ASYNCHRONOUS)
-			ret = uvc_ctrl_set_handle(handle, ctrl, handle);
+			ret = uvc_ctrl_set_handle(handle, ctrl);
 
 		if (ret < 0 && !rollback) {
 			if (err_ctrl)
@@ -3271,7 +3276,7 @@  void uvc_ctrl_cleanup_fh(struct uvc_fh *handle)
 		for (unsigned int i = 0; i < entity->ncontrols; ++i) {
 			if (entity->controls[i].handle != handle)
 				continue;
-			uvc_ctrl_set_handle(handle, &entity->controls[i], NULL);
+			uvc_ctrl_clear_handle(handle, &entity->controls[i]);
 		}
 	}
